Preseason is the time to organize, practice, and evaluate. The Packers, like most teams, run basic formations and plays. The idea is to build, day by day, until you have a strong team. Fundamentals are the order of the day. Evaluations are based upon fundamentals. It's not reasonable to expect the Packers to try to teach advanced plays in Training Camp.
